Microchip Technology's MCP23S08-E/SS: 8-Bit I/O Expander with Serial Interface
The MCP23S08-E/SS is a versatile 8-bit I/O (Input/Output) expander from Microchip Technology, designed to provide additional I/O capabilities to a microcontroller via the SPI (Serial Peripheral Interface) bus. This integrated circuit is particularly useful in applications where extra GPIOs (General Purpose Input/Output) are needed, making it an ideal choice for expanding the functionality of microcontroller-based systems.
This I/O expander comes in a compact SSOP (Shrink Small Outline Package) form factor, which is both space-efficient and suitable for automated assembly processes. The part number suffix 'E' indicates the extended temperature range, ensuring reliable performance under varying environmental conditions, which is crucial for industrial and automotive applications.
Key Features of the MCP23S08-E/SS:
- 8-bit I/O Expansion: Provides eight additional I/O ports that can be individually configured as input or output, offering flexibility for a wide range of applications.
- Serial Interface: The device uses the SPI protocol for communication, which enables high-speed data transfer and easy interfacing with most microcontrollers.
- Interrupt Output: An interrupt output pin can be configured to alert the host microcontroller of input changes, reducing the need for continuous polling and saving power.
- Configurable Polarity: Input polarity inversion registers allow users to adapt the I/O expander to their specific needs without altering the logic in their firmware.
- Addressing Flexibility: Up to four MCP23S08-E/SS devices can share the same SPI bus, thanks to three hardware address pins, enabling control of up to 32 I/Os.
- Extended Temperature Range: The device operates reliably over an extended temperature range, making it suitable for harsh environments.
The MCP23S08-E/SS is a practical solution for system designers looking to increase the I/O capabilities of their projects without the need for larger microcontrollers or additional boards. Its robust feature set and ease of integration make it a popular choice for expanding the functionality of embedded systems in a wide array of industries, including automotive, consumer electronics, and industrial automation.
For detailed technical specifications, pin configurations, and application examples, visit the Microchip Technology website or refer to the MCP23S08-E/SS datasheet.